THE Ministry of Social Welfare, Relief and Resettlement has announced that there is a need for people to be careful because landslides are common during June, July and August.
The statement says landslides cause very little loss of property, but the loss of human life and injuries are high. There were 26 landslides nationwide, 36 residential buildings were damaged, and 44 people lost their lives during the 2023-2024 financial year. Landslides are common from June to August and occur occasionally during the rest of the period.
Therefore, the Ministry of Social Welfare, Relief and Resettlement is working to protect the people with the participation of the public in order to reduce the damage caused by the landslides.
In addition, the Ministry of Social Welfare, Relief and Resettlement has announced that people can request assistance regarding natural disasters by contacting the 24-hour hotline numbers 067 3404 666 and 067 3404777.
